掌握Ionic基础:创建自定义SCSS支持的Ionic项目
需积分: 5 132 浏览量
更新于2024-11-04
收藏 1.3MB ZIP 举报
资源摘要信息:"本资源文档主要涉及Ionic框架及其认证机制的介绍和使用。文档的标题为'ionicAuthentication',其内容主要涉及如何利用Ionic框架创建一个带有认证机制的移动应用程序的起始项目。Ionic是一个开源的移动应用开发框架,可以让开发者使用Web技术开发跨平台的移动应用。描述中介绍了创建Ionic项目的基本步骤,包括如何使用命令行工具ionic以及如何利用自定义SCSS进行样式定制。同时,文档也建议使用ionic实用程序创建基于此项目的新Ionic项目,并提供了创建项目时的命令行示例。此外,还提到了如何安装项目依赖以及如何使用该项目作为Ionic应用程序的基础。"
知识点:
1. Ionic框架基础:
Ionic是一个流行的开源移动应用开发框架,允许开发者使用Web技术(如HTML、CSS、JavaScript)来构建跨平台的移动应用。Ionic应用通常使用AngularJS作为其前端技术,但也可以与其他前端框架或原生技术配合使用。
2. 自定义SCSS的使用:
SCSS(Sassy CSS)是CSS的一个预处理器,它扩展了CSS语言,允许开发者使用变量、嵌套规则、混合、函数等特性。在Ionic项目中使用SCSS,可以提高样式代码的复用性和可维护性。文档提到,可以使用自定义SCSS,这意味着开发人员可以在项目中自定义样式,以满足特定的设计需求。
3. Ionic项目创建方法:
文档中提供了一个使用命令行工具创建Ionic项目的示例,即通过运行"ionic start myProject tabs"命令来创建一个带有默认选项卡界面的新项目。这里使用了tabs选项卡布局,这是Ionic框架提供的标准布局之一,可以快速搭建起包含多个页面的应用结构。
4. ionic实用程序:
ionic实用程序是一个跨平台的命令行界面工具,用于开发和构建Ionic应用程序。通过安装ionic实用程序,开发者可以快速搭建项目框架,并且方便地添加额外的功能和组件。
5. GitHub克隆存储库:
文档建议开发者可以从GitHub上克隆"ionicAppBase"存储库来获取项目的源代码。这是开源项目常用的协作开发方式,允许开发者获取项目源代码并在本地进行开发和测试。
6. 安装项目依赖:
在文档中提到了需要运行"sudo npm install"命令来安装项目依赖,这暗示了Ionic项目是基于npm(Node.js包管理器)构建的。通过运行npm安装命令,可以下载并安装项目所需的所有第三方库和模块。
7. JavaScript:
在文档的标签中提到了JavaScript,这是构建Ionic应用的主要编程语言。尽管Ionic框架利用了AngularJS、React、Vue等现代JavaScript框架和库,但其核心依然是JavaScript。这强调了在开发Ionic应用时,JavaScript编程能力的重要性。
总结来说,这份文档涉及到Ionic开发的多个重要方面,包括项目创建、依赖管理、样式定制以及利用GitHub进行源代码协作。它为初学者提供了一个清晰的起点,帮助他们开始构建自己的Ionic应用,并通过实践来深入了解框架的特性和最佳实践。
2024-12-24 上传
2024-12-24 上传
人间发财树
- 粉丝: 28
- 资源: 4560
最新资源
- RPMA回传+ Arduino Yun –第3部分-项目开发
- easy-redux:简化redux api
- BarreOutils:锻炼巴雷特迪尔斯
- copylight:jQuery 插件为内容许可证提供视觉强化
- 2021最新孜然导航系统 v1.0
- 微信小程序-小厨房
- visibl:通过React HOC进行视口内检测
- canvasinvaders:HTML Canvas 上的太空入侵者(有点)
- clickhousewriter.zip
- 西门子PLC工程实例源码第637期:转速PID控制程序(双脉冲).rar
- 洗剂
- 物理和云Cayenne交换机-项目开发
- fit-text-to-screen:
- CSYE6220:CSYE6220的分配
- ChatBot
- FJLRS:费·琼斯实验室请求系统